ProjectsIn 2020, the rebrand of Kask Snow marked a pivotal moment for the brand, redefining its positioning and visual identity in the highly competitive snow sports market. This comprehensive rebrand centered around the concept of ‘Preparation,’ emphasising its importance as the foundation for performance on the slopes. The rebrand not only reshaped the brand’s look and feel but also aligned its narrative with the precision, focus, and determination required in ski culture.

Project Overview

The rebrand encompassed a complete overhaul of Kask Snow’s creative direction, including art direction, casting, digital assets, and physical brand presence. A meticulously crafted suite of marketing materials was developed, culminating in an immersive experience at the IPSO Show in Munich.

Creative Direction

• A new visual language was introduced, embodying elegance, precision, and modernity to resonate with both seasoned skiers and the new generation of snow sports enthusiasts.

• The tone and messaging revolved around the theme of ‘Preparation Is Everything’ connecting the meticulous nature of skiing with Kask’s dedication to craftsmanship and innovation.

Art Direction & Casting

• The art direction for the campaign emphasized dynamic motion and pristine alpine settings, capturing the beauty and intensity of preparation before hitting the slopes.

• Casting focused on a diverse range of athletes and models, each embodying the discipline, skill, and passion central to the world of skiing.

Microsite for the New Collection

• A sleek, intuitive microsite was designed to showcase the new collection, offering a seamless user experience.

• Features included 360-degree product views, an interactive sizing guide, and immersive storytelling elements that brought the “Preparation” concept to life.

Lookbook: ‘Snow’

• The lookbook titled ‘Snow’ served as a visual manifesto of the rebrand, blending aspirational imagery with technical details of the collection.

• Printed on premium materials, it became a collector’s item for retailers and customers alike, further solidifying Kask Snow’s position as a luxury performance brand.

Brand Film: ‘Preparation’

• A cinematic brand film highlighted the ritual of preparation before skiing, capturing the quiet moments of focus and the powerful connection between athlete and environment.

• The film was released across digital platforms, driving engagement and setting the tone for the rebrand.

IPSO Show Event in Munich

• The rebrand culminated in an immersive brand experience at the IPSO Show in Munich, where the new identity was brought to life.

• The exhibit featured:

Interactive displays showcasing the new collection.

Live screenings of the brand film.

• A curated installation that walked visitors through the rebranding journey and the philosophy of ‘Preparation’.

• The event was praised for its innovation and design, leaving a lasting impression on industry insiders and attendees.
